Course Content

• **Technical Vocabulary Acquisition Strategies:** This unit focuses on effective methods for learning and retaining STEM-specific terminology, including strategies like context clues, morphemic analysis, and using flashcards/visual aids.
• **Scientific Measurement and Units:** Covering fundamental units (SI units, metric system) and their application in various STEM fields. Keywords: *measurement, metric system, SI units*.
• **Engineering Terminology (Civil, Mechanical, Electrical):** Introduction to key terms across various engineering disciplines, focusing on commonalities and differences in terminology. Keywords: *engineering, civil engineering, mechanical engineering, electrical engineering*.
• **Data Analysis and Interpretation Vocabulary:** Understanding terms related to statistics, graphs, charts, and data representation in research reports and presentations. Keywords: *data analysis, statistics, graphs, charts*.
• **Biotechnology and Life Science Vocabulary:** Focuses on key terms within cellular biology, genetics, molecular biology, and biotechnology. Keywords: *biotechnology, genetics, cellular biology*.
• **Chemistry and Materials Science Terminology:** Explores fundamental concepts and terminology related to chemical reactions, materials properties, and chemical processes. Keywords: *chemistry, materials science, chemical reactions*.
• **Presentation and Report Writing Skills:** This unit emphasizes the accurate use of vocabulary within formal academic settings like reports and presentations. Keywords: *technical writing, academic writing, report writing*.
• **Advanced Vocabulary Building Techniques:** Utilizing dictionaries, thesauri, and online resources for in-depth exploration of technical terms and their nuances. Keywords: *vocabulary building, terminology, technical dictionary*.
